Output 8518ec52a329eac498ead507532a381d2c90acb8a76a260b1e86dd7756314741:2

value
32167342
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 be0209269d9998d0eacf0c173472ed7a6012aaaf OP_EQUALVERIFY OP_CHECKSIG
address
1JKfptqvtCjwKA7wZ85Zq3CdFaoFxXhC2a
transaction
8518ec52a329eac498ead507532a381d2c90acb8a76a260b1e86dd7756314741
spent
true